KLM Executes Emergency Pickup for Passengers After Flight Makes Emergency Landing in Norway
KLM is sending a plane to Oslo to retrieve passengers from a Boeing 737 that made an emergency landing in Norway due to a malfunction. The flight was en route from Oslo to Amsterdam when pilots detected smoke from the left engine shortly after takeoff. Passengers were safely transported to Oslo and will be assisted by KLM at both locations. A technical team will investigate the incident.
